The relationship between wedding planners and church coordinators has long been marked by tension, misunderstandings, and at times, outright conflict. But what if there’s a better way forward?
In this episode, Emma Cockerham, Certified Educator and Master Certified Wedding Planner, joins Krisy Thomas, COO of The CWP Society, for a candid conversation on transforming these often-strained relationships into true partnerships.
Emma shares her personal journey through church wedding burnout in 2019, when a series of difficult experiences left her both professionally and spiritually discouraged. Instead of walking away, she leaned into education and a new approach, proving that change is possible. Together, Krisy and Emma unpack the persistent myths that fuel conflict: the idea that planners are inherently disrespectful, that church coordinators dismiss the bigger picture, and that media teams are encouraged to ignore rules.
Through real-life stories and practical strategies, Emma highlights how humility, communication, and respect can reshape even the toughest dynamics. From navigating media restrictions to clarifying a planner’s role within the ceremony, she offers actionable ways to foster collaboration. A particularly compelling story involves her persistence in building trust with a Catholic church coordinator, a relationship once fraught with conflict that became one of genuine respect.
Emma discusses the importance of research and entering every church setting with reverence, regardless of personal religious background.
Whether you’ve experienced church wedding challenges firsthand or want to avoid them altogether, this conversation gives you a framework for becoming a true peacemaker. As Emma reminds us, wedding planning is about bringing diverse vendors together to create something beautiful, and that begins with mutual respect.
